Bridesmaid, 1974


Uploaded for the Vintage Photos Theme Park theme of: AT THE WEDDING (but not the bride or groom).
Here's me with my mother at my cousin's wedding.
I'm not happy for two reasons:
1. I really don't want her to get married to the groom
and
2. It's 106 F - I kid you not - PLUS it's Connecticut and unbearably humid.
And -
Neither the church or the place where the reception was held had air conditioning.
The color in this photo does not do justice to my actual face color which was the red of a 26 mile marathon.
Not my favorite memory - or the bride's, it turned out.
